Health Insurance is the second episode of season seven of Malcolm in the Middle.

Plot

After Hal forgets to pay the family's health insurance, the company won't reinstate it until Monday, so he panics. He locks up every sharp or dangerous object in the house, a category in which he thinks mere spoons belong, in the garage, accidentally leaving Jamie in the middle of the pile of knives, pokers, and chainsaws. He also locks up the boys in their room to keep them from getting hurt, but ends up hurting himself. The boys lie to Lois on Hal's behalf and take him to a veterinarian to treat him. Meanwhile, Lois thinks that Craig is snitching to the boss about the employees starting a union. She insinuates this to the rest of the Lucky Aide staff, and they beat Craig up. It is later revealed that Craig is, in fact, not the snitch, and he was merely planning a surprise party for Lois.

  • Hal reveals that he once left Dewey in Mexico. Possibly the first time Hal tried to reach the ranch and ended up in Mexico instead, which Francis mentioned in an earlier episode.
